So in order to not put the cart before the horse, Scream fans last saw that everyone was dealing with Jake’s death in their own way. Some were taking it pretty hard, others were taking it in stride. But Brooke broke down, then lost her marbles.

In her mind, the new Scream killer was Branson, who she lured into a bed and then handcuffed him. Can anyone say Femme Fatale? Of course not, because sweet little Brooke would never do anything awful like that, right. Brooke was the kind of girl on Scream who would assassinate your character, not your actual living body. And surely she would not torture anyone, right?

Think again! Scream fans got to see the new side of Brooke, who is willing to do anything to get the answers she craves most, which include finding out who the killer is. That includes a slash on Branson’s face, seemingly to prove that she was serious about finding out what he had to do with the murder.

Of course, Branson did not give in to that and that was all it took to convince Brooke. Now the educated Scream fan will read more into that scene than most, considering the Scream franchise likes to take all suspicion off of their killer before he/she is revealed.

Then there was that shot of Noah foolishly getting tricked into a late night meet up by the killer. But Audrey came along and ruined his plans with a little surprise of her own, faking both of their kidnappings and leading the killer to both of them, plus Emma, plus Kieran. They ran for their lives, but the killer was more interested in going and finding Branson, who was still tied up in Brooke’s little rendezvous.

That is the part where Scream took fans back to the gore with a hand getting hacked off, then cauterized, leaving Branson alive but disfigured.

So in the next episode of Scream, Emma goes on a trip with Eli, but Brooke and Audrey, the two main suspects for fans, will get lured into a trap by the killer. But Scream fans should not be fooled into thinking they are both innocent at that point.
